py-contract-codegen

py-contract-codegen is a command-line tool for generating Python code from Ethereum ABI.

Installation

pip install py-contract-codegen

Commands

  1. gen: Generate Python code from an Ethereum ABI file.
  2. version: Show the version of the code generator.

gen Command

The gen command is used to generate Python code from an Ethereum ABI.

py-contract-codegen gen [OPTIONS]

Options

╭─ Options ─────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────╮
│ --abi-path                              PATH               Path to ABI file. If not provided, `--abi-stdin` or `--contract-address` must be set [default: None]                       │
│ --abi-stdin           --no-abi-stdin                       ABI content from stdin [default: no-abi-stdin]                                                                             │
│ --contract-address                      TEXT               Auto fetch abi from etherscan and generate code. Please set environment variable `ETHERSCAN_API_KEY` [default: None]       │
│ --out-file                              PATH               Path to save file name the generated code. If not provided, prints to stdout [default: None]                               │
│ --class-name                            TEXT               Contract Class Name to save the generated code. If not provided, use `GeneratedContract` [default: GeneratedContract]      │
│ --target-lib                            [web3_v7|web3_v6]  Target library and version [default: web3_v7]                                                                              │
│ --network                               [mainnet|sepolia]  Ethereum network for fetching ABI [default: mainnet]                                                                       │
│ --help                                                     Show this message and exit.                                                                                                │
╰───────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────────╯

Command Examples

Gen from ABI file

py-contract-codegen gen --abi-path {ABI_FILE_PATH} --out-file generated_contract.py

Gen from stdin

cat {ABI_FILE_PATH} | py-contract-codegen gen --abi-stdin --out-file generated_contract.py

Gen from Contract Address

It automatically generates code by fetching the ABI through Etherscan API.

The contract's source code needs to be verified on Etherscan.

Please set environment variable ETHERSCAN_API_KEY.

py-contract-codegen gen --contract-address {CONTRACT_ADDRESS} --out-file generated_contract.py

Examples

To use the generated contract, you need to install web3.py.

Here's an example of a generated contract:

ERC20

from web3 import Web3
from eth_account import Account

w3 = Web3(provider=Web3.HTTPProvider("{YOUR_PROVIDER_URL}"))
private_key = "{YOUR_PRIVATE_KEY}"
contract_address = w3.to_checksum_address("{YOUR_CONTRACT_ADDRESS}")
to_address = w3.to_checksum_address("{YOUR_TO_ADDRESS}")

contract = GeneratedContract(contract_address=contract_address, web3=w3)
account = Account.from_key(private_key)

# balanceOf
balance = contract.balanceOf(to_address)

# transfer
transfer = contract.transfer(to_address, 1)
nonce = w3.eth.get_transaction_count(account.address)
build_tx = transfer.build_transaction({"from": account.address, "nonce": nonce})
signed_tx = account.sign_transaction(build_tx)
tx_hash = w3.eth.send_raw_transaction(signed_tx.rawTransaction)
w3.eth.wait_for_transaction_receipt(tx_hash)
